Camp Membership Dues:
Annual
Membership dues are based on .00155* of all income available for
summer operations, including tuition, fees, dividends, camperships
and contributions. Exclude all capital funds. The minimum dues are $100, the maximum payable
is on a scale determined by Camp revenue see chart below.
|
Revenue of $1M- <$2M |
Fees due: |
$1600 |
|
Revenue of $2M- <3M |
Fees due: |
$1800 |
|
Revenue of $3M & over |
Fees due: |
$2000 |
*Day camps calculate .0010 of summer income (Minimum $100)
Dues provide
you with one voting member, who will receive MYCA
mailings, newsletters and other information.
Introductory ½ price dues available for first time members.
